Monmouth - John James Hubbard, 48, passed away on August 26, 2012 at Salem Hospital. He was born March 12, 1964 to John and Maryanne Hubbard in Petaluma, California.
John attended Western Oregon University, and graduated from Dallas High School in 1983. He worked as a Chief Financial Officer for Pratum Co-op and Mountain View Seeds. He married Mary Carter in 1991 on June 6 at the Independence Assembly Of God.
His hobbies and interests included fishing and hiking with his kids. He loved to bbq and cook for his family, he put lots of love into it. He also liked to take the grandkids out to pick blackberries and play with them. They are his life and legacy. One of his many talents that not many got to see is his paintings. They are so full of life and show his personality.
He served in the Army and went to Officer Candidate School.
He was a Past Master at The Masonic Lodge in Independence Oregon. He was also a member of the Shriners.
His family was his passion, the heart of soul of his life.
He is survived by his wife Mary of Monmouth; son Richard of Monmouth, daughter Cassandra of Monmouth, Daughters Sara and Jasmine of North Pole Alaska, and Son Jonathan Hubbard of North Pole, Alaska. He has 4 grandchildren; father John Hubbard of Vancouver, WA; mother Maryanne of Salem.
